Output 6e821fd663ae548f53d578fd65ab2ebf38f8d25cb8b4de1fefee698237a9e484:3

value
66771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dbe2f63f9c0714e334adc06a3be221a8505506a OP_EQUAL
address
34QHMQBpQtqwhtB7Bv86DLCayJV41iTbcj
transaction
6e821fd663ae548f53d578fd65ab2ebf38f8d25cb8b4de1fefee698237a9e484
spent
true